Abstract

Official abstract text for this publication.

A method for weight off wheel shock strut servicing includes deflating the shock strut, compressing the shock strut via a jack until the shock strut is in a compressed position, charging the shock strut with an oil until a pressure of the oil reduces a volume of a residual air located inside of the shock strut, lowering the jack until a shock strut piston reaches a pre-determined extension, and charging the shock strut with a gas until the gas comprises a pre-determined pressure.

What is claimed is: 1. A method for weight off wheel shock strut servicing comprising: deflating a shock strut; compressing the shock strut via a jack until the shock strut is in a compressed position; charging the shock strut with an oil until a pressure of the oil reduces a volume of a residual air located inside of the shock strut; lowering the jack until a shock strut piston reaches a pre-determined extension, wherein the pre-determined extension is determined, at least in part, based upon a servicing temperature; and charging the shock strut with a gas until the gas comprises a pre-determined pressure. 2. The method of claim 1 , wherein the charging the shock strut with the oil comprises pumping the oil into a second valve and closing a first valve in response to the oil exiting the shock strut via the first valve. 3. The method of claim 1 , wherein the deflating comprises releasing the gas from the shock strut. 4. The method of claim 1 , wherein the pre-determined pressure is determined, at least in part, based upon a servicing temperature. 5. The method of claim 1 , wherein the shock strut is charged with the oil while maintaining the shock strut in the compressed position.
